COVID-19 : JK records 20th death

Srinagar, May 21 : The death toll due to COVID-19 a deadly virus has mounted to 20 in Jammu and Kashmir as now 80 year old woman from Sringar died at SMHS.

A health official told news agency KINS, A 80 year old lady from Usmania Colony, Bemina Srinagar was admitted in SMHS Hospital Srinagar with bilateral pneumonia and hypertension on 19 May and was kept in Isolation Ward, died on 20 May evening and was kept in GMC Srinagar mortuary. Her COVID test report came today as COVID positive.

With her death, the toll due to the coronavirus in Jammu and Kashmir has risen to 20—18 from Kashmir and 2 from Jammu division.
